 The BigEagle's - Warron, Debra & Alexandra Sage have the luxury of country living on a small farm, 40 miles East of Oklahoma City off Interstate 40 in Shawnee, Oklahoma.  We are a Blended Family; combining Native American and Christian teachings, along with Open-mindedness to shape Our way of life. 

Debra chose the name for the new business from the two people that inspire her. Her Grammie, who taught her to perserve food & make fudge and her daughter Alexandra Sage. 

Grammie Sage Farm consists of 8 Hens, a herd of Nigerian Dwarf goats. Along with 6 Guineas, 3 Kaki Campbell ducks, 3 Paint Horses, 2 cats, 3 Shetland Sheep dogs all living on the farm. We added a Bull Mastiff mix girl, Holly, to keep our outside animals and Alexandra safe. You can get Free Range Brown eggs for $2.50 a dozen and soon we will have products using our goat's milk. We have had 13 1/2 inches of rain in 1 month and now we have Heat Index's of 110*.
